P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Ralleybuchungen



Rens
31.01.2010, 17:19
hu also hab jetzt alles mögliche hier durchkämmt - im vms 1.2.4 thread steht ja schon eine korrektur für die ralleys drinne aber es erscheint nix in den buchungslisten einzig die refrallye funzt

ausserdem:
wenn ich auf auswerten klicke wird der betrag dem user gutgeschrieben und im adminforce steht "ausgewertet am..." wenn ich die seite neu lade steht bei ausgewertet nix und ich kann nochmal klicken und der user bekommt den betrag auch nochmal gutgeschrieben aber in der buchungsliste ist wieder nix

kennt das psrob jemand ?

jpwfour
31.01.2010, 21:57
Jo, jetzt wo dus sagst, mir scheint, der alte Fehler wurde behoben, und gleich ein neuer eingebaut:


buchungsliste ($buchungs_id,'konto',$buchungssumme,'Klickralley (Platz '.$rp.')',$pa['uid']);Ist natürlich falsch, vermutlich hat da wer eigene Addons, und das dann da reingepackt (kommt an sich ja nur Gremlin in Frage?)

Also ändern in:

buchungsliste ($buchungs_id,$buchungssumme,'Klickralley (Platz '.$rp.')',$pa['uid']);

Das man mehrmals auswerten kann, ist halt so, sollte aber kaum ein Problem darstellen (einfach nach auswertung reseten)

Rens
31.01.2010, 22:34
japp vielen dank das hats gebracht :) muss ich dann nu ma eben in allen ralleys ändern

didith1207
01.02.2010, 10:56
von wann ist dein script? hast du die neue vms version oder die erste da das eigentlich gefixt wurde!

http://www.designerscripte.net/showpost.php?p=74050&postcount=23

Rens
01.02.2010, 12:45
ich hab mir die letzte aktuelle version anfang januar hier ausm download gezogen und hab auch eben festgestellt dass der einzige unterschied in dem code das '+' war aber das hats gebracht - warum auch immer...
ich hab auch mit sämtlichen sql befehlen probleme - vielleicht nicht ganz der passende hoster fürs vms

didith1207
01.02.2010, 14:29
was ist das für ein hoster und gib mal ein beispiel für die sql die probleme machen und eventuel die fehlermeldung dazu..

Rens
01.02.2010, 15:16
hoster ist samcity... da werd ich eh früher oder später weg müssen weil die jede seite die "hohe datenbankauslastung" erzeugt - löscht - nur weiß ich nicht was genau mit der db auslastung als hoch eingestuft wird

das mit den fehlern muss ich zurücknehmen mir ist aufgefallen dass sämtliche addons die ich einbauen wollte vom 1.1 waren - hatte die ganzen klamotten noch von nem alten projekt gespeichert damit ich mir jetzt am anfang keine neuen slots kaufen muss etc. - aber ich hab trotzdem nochmal einen eingebaut um ihn dir zu zeigen:
Warning: mysql_real_escape_string() [function.mysql-real-escape-string]: Access denied for user 'apache'@'localhost' (using password: NO) in /home/nismo/domains/nismo.onpw.de/public_html/vms/lib/functions.lib.php on line 64

Warning: mysql_real_escape_string() [function.mysql-real-escape-string]: A link to the server could not be established in /home/nismo/domains/nismo.onpw.de/public_html/vms/lib/functions.lib.php on line 64

Warning: mysql_query() [function.mysql-query]: Access denied for user 'apache'@'localhost' (using password: NO) in /home/nismo/domains/nismo.onpw.de/public_html/vms/lib/functions.lib.php on line 69

Warning: mysql_query() [function.mysql-query]: A link to the server could not be established in /home/nismo/domains/nismo.onpw.de/public_html/vms/lib/functions.lib.php on line 69

das passiert wenn man beim supportticket addon die zeile:
db_query("UPDATE ".$db_prefix."_support SET status=2 WHERE status=1 AND time<".(time()-(5*86400)));
in die functions.lib einbaut

eine ähnliche meldung hatte ich bei maddins shoutbox in verbindung mit dem "ralleys auf der startseite" schnippzel - der trat übrigens nur nach nem post auf hat man dann die seite neu geladen war kein fehler zu sehen

nu hab ich die ralleys von der startseite gekickt und alles läuft

didith1207
01.02.2010, 21:54
db_query("UPDATE ".$db_prefix."_support SET status=2 WHERE status=1 AND time<".(time()-(5*86400)));
diese zeile gehört in den header nicht in die funktionslib

Rens
01.02.2010, 22:40
4. In der Datei /lib/functions.lib.php ganz am Ende, aber noch VOR ?> hinzufügen:

db_query("UPDATE ".$db_prefix."_support SET status=2 WHERE status=1 AND time<".(time()-(5*86400)));

steht so in der anleitung... werds mal mitm header ausprobieren...

€dit: jo funzt :) - wenn ich nu noch wüsste welche funktion der code hat könnt ich auch sagen ob er richtig funzt :D

wie kann man das ding eigentlich so ändern dass man keine supportanfrage ohne "Betreff" absenden kann - ich kann die nämlich im admin nicht öffnen wenn die keinen betreff haben

jpwfour
02.02.2010, 00:01
...
wie kann man das ding eigentlich so ändern dass man keine supportanfrage ohne "Betreff" absenden kann - ich kann die nämlich im admin nicht öffnen wenn die keinen betreff haben

Bin mir eigentlich sicher, dass da sowas wie:

if(trim($_POST['betreff'])=='')$_POST['betreff']='Kein Betreff';
drinsteht, insofern müssten die ja 'nen Betreff haben?

Evtl mein ich auch ein anderes Addon, aber dann hilft dir der Code sicher weiter.

Rens
02.02.2010, 00:33
nö der hat gefehlt aber habs an passender stelle eingebaut und klappt - vielen dank